The Amsoil 15W-50 Synthetic Metric Motorcycle Oil (MFFQT) is a high-viscosity, premium lubricant specifically engineered for engines that require maximum protection against extreme heat and heavy mechanical shear. It is the ideal choice for high-performance adventure bikes, large-displacement metric cruisers, and touring motorcycles from brands like Royal Enfield, BMW, KTM, and Triumph.

 

Key Performance Benefits

  • Superior Wear Protection: Exceeds industry standards for high-temperature film strength. This ensures that even in heavy stop-and-go traffic or under high-load touring, critical engine components remain lubricated and protected from metal-to-metal contact.

     

  • Smooth, Confident Shifts: Formulated without friction modifiers to ensure positive wet-clutch engagement. This design prevents clutch slippage and glazing, which is vital for maintaining a consistent "wrist-to-rear-wheel" feel.

     

  • Extreme Thermal Stability: Resists oxidation and volatility, preventing the formation of damaging sludge and carbon deposits. This keeps the engine internals clean and helps the oil maintain its specified viscosity longer than standard lubricants.

     

  • Advanced Foam Control: Contains specialized anti-foam additives that prevent air bubbles from forming at high RPMs. This ensures a consistent oil film is delivered to gear teeth and bearings even when pushing the bike to its limits.

     

  • Superior Rust Protection: Features a high Total Base Number (TBN) of 11.6, providing excellent protection against acid corrosion and rust during long periods of storage or inactivity.

     

Technical Specifications

Feature Specification
Viscosity Grade SAE 15W-50
Industry Standards API SM, JASO MA/MA2
Service Life Up to 2X the manufacturer interval (or one year)
Pour Point -39°C (-38°F)
Flash Point 240°C (464°F)
